Workforce Strategy Partners Programme

The Workforce Strategy Partners Programme (WSPP) is a funding scheme provided by the Children's Workforce Development Council (CWDC) to support third and private sector engagement in workforce reform.

Regional WSPP

Between February and July 2008, the CWDC funded a small number of pilot projects to test the feasibility of extending the WSPP to a regional level. In particular, it was keen to see whether the WSPP funding stream would be an appropriate way to assist the development of regional strategies and action plans to increase the engagement of the third and private sectors in workforce development and to add value to work taking place through local WSPP projects in the region. Local WSPP 

In April 2007, an allocation of funding was made available to each Children's Trust in England to support local WSPP work for a period of three years. The nature of WSPP projects differed from area to area, due to the focus on local workforce strategies, and the specific priorities with each local area.
